Frequently Asked Questions about cottages in British Columbia

  • Is British Columbia, Canada a good destination to rent a cottage?

    Absolutely! British Columbia offers fantastic cottage rentals, especially around lakes like Okanagan Lake, Shuswap Lake, and Kootenay Lake. Coastal areas like the Sunshine Coast and Vancouver Island also have many charming cottage options. The availability and types of cottages vary greatly depending on the season and location, so booking in advance is recommended.

  • What weather, wildlife, or natural hazards might affect travelers in British Columbia, Canada?

    British Columbia's weather is diverse. Expect mild, rainy winters on the coast and snowy winters in the mountains. Summers are warm and dry inland, but can be cool and wet on the coast. Wildlife includes bears (grizzly and black), cougars, and deer. Always store food properly and maintain a safe distance from wildlife. Natural hazards include landslides in mountainous areas and occasional wildfires, particularly during summer months. Check weather and wildfire reports before and during your trip.

  • Are there any unusual or hidden places to explore in British Columbia, Canada?

    Absolutely! The Cathedral Grove in MacMillan Provincial Park on Vancouver Island features massive ancient Douglas fir trees. The abandoned ghost town of Barkerville in Wells is a fascinating glimpse into BC's gold rush history. For a unique experience, consider exploring some of the many hot springs scattered throughout the province, like the Harrison Hot Springs.

  • What are the best authentic dishes to taste in British Columbia, Canada?

    Try fresh seafood like salmon, halibut, and Dungeness crab, often prepared simply to highlight their natural flavors. Wild mushrooms are a regional specialty, appearing in many dishes. BC also produces excellent wines, particularly in the Okanagan Valley, and craft beers are widely available. For a unique experience, try some Indigenous cuisine which features wild game and traditional cooking techniques.

  • Are there any recommended items to pack for a stay in British Columbia, Canada?

    Pack layers of clothing, as the weather can change quickly. Include rain gear, sturdy hiking boots, and insect repellent, especially during warmer months. A reusable water bottle is essential. If you plan on hiking or camping, bear spray is also recommended, particularly in areas known for bear activity. Check the specific requirements for any activities you plan to engage in.
